The Different Types of Fireplaces
Before diving into the sales and promotions, it is necessary to understand the different types of fireplaces offered. Each type features its own advantages, drawbacks, and maintenance requirements.
| Kind of Fireplace | Advantages | Downsides |
|---|---|---|
| Wood-Burning | Genuine ambiance, affordable fuel | Requires regular upkeep, emissions issues |
| Gas | Immediate heat, simpler to use, cleaner | Needs gas line installation, greater preliminary cost |
| Electric | Easy setup, no ventilation required | Less heat output, based on electricity |
| Bioethanol | Environment-friendly, no smoke or soot | Minimal heat output, more expensive fuel |
1. Wood-Burning Fireplaces
For many, the nostalgia of a crackling fire is unrivaled. Wood-burning fireplaces provide a traditional experience complete with special scents and the sounds of burning wood. Nevertheless, they need regular cleaning of ash and creosote, along with a constant supply of wood.
2. Gas Fireplaces
Gas fireplaces are a popular choice for those looking for convenience. They spark with the flip of a switch and supply a consistent stream of heat. Nevertheless, they might need professional setup and can be more pricey at first.
3. Electric Fireplaces
For those who prioritize ease of use and flexibility, electric fireplaces present an outstanding alternative. They can be portable, require no ventilation, and offer various aesthetic styles, but they may not provide as much heat as traditional fireplaces.
4. Bioethanol Fireplaces
Suitable for environmentally mindful homeowners, bioethanol fireplaces utilize clean-burning fuel and develop no smoke. They can be placed practically anywhere, but their heating capabilities are fairly restricted.
Key Considerations When Buying a Fireplace
When checking out fireplaces for sale, potential purchasers must think about several important elements.
1. Size and Space
- Procedure the room where the fireplace will be set up to guarantee you pick the ideal size.
- Consider the height of the ceiling, as this can impact how well the fireplace warms the space.
2. Heating Capacity
- Identify just how much heat you need. This often depends upon the square footage of the room.
- Try to find the BTU (British Thermal Units) rating, especially for gas models.
3. Style and Design
- Pick a design that matches your home's design.
- Pick between traditional, modern, rustic, and different surfaces.
4. Fuel Source
- Consider the availability and cost of the fuel source in your area-- wood, gas, electricity, or bioethanol.
- Remember the environmental impact of each alternative.
5. Spending plan
- Set a spending plan that includes not only the expense of the fireplace itself but likewise installation and ongoing maintenance.
- Search for seasonal sales or discounted prices which can be discovered at various home enhancement stores.
6. Brand Reputation
- Research brands to discover those with trusted warranties and excellent client evaluations.
- Check for accreditations and efficiency rankings.
The Best Time to Buy a Fireplace
Fireplaces, being a seasonal product, are often subject to sales during specific times of the year. The very best times to snag deals on fireplaces include:
- End of Winter: Many retailers discount rate fireplaces to clear out stock before the warmer seasons.
- Early Fall: As the chillier weather condition methods, sales may strike attract early buyers.
- Vacation Sales: Look for Black Friday, Cyber Monday, and year-end sales for discounts on holiday specials.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: What is the most budget-friendly type of fireplace?
A: Wood-burning fireplaces are frequently the most cost-efficient relating to fuel, but they require more maintenance than gas or electric models.
Q2: Are electric fireplaces safe to utilize?

Q3: Can I install a gas fireplace myself?
A: While some installation elements can be DIY, it is advised to have a professional install a gas fireplace to guarantee safety and compliance with local codes.
Q4: How do I preserve my fireplace?
A: Maintenance differs by type, however generally involves routine cleaning, examining for leakages, and guaranteeing correct ventilation for gas units.
Q5: What should I do if I smell smoke from my fireplace?
A: If you detect smoke, right away turn off and stop using it. Examine for obstructions or employ a professional to evaluate your system.
